[sync] Problems when synchronizing SE W880i calendar

Karsten Fourmont fourmont at gmx.de
Sun Aug 26 15:05:49 UTC 2007


Hi,

I think you just need to upgrade your horde/kronolith/config/prefs.php
to the current prefs.php.dist: there's a new array for alarm methods in 
there.

BTW, I simply use symlinks from the *.dist files to the config files in 
cases where the defaults are fine with me. (that's most cases actually.)
Keeps you automatically up to date.

Cheers,
  Karsten


Anders Tietze wrote:
> Hi,
> 
> Here is the requested calendar entry:
> 
> input received from client (text/calendar)
> BEGIN:VCALENDAR
> VERSION:1.0
> BEGIN:VEVENT
> DTSTART:20071204T180000Z
> DTEND:20071204T183000Z
> DESCRIPTION:
> SUMMARY:Test event
> DALARM:20071204T174500Z
> AALARM:20071204T174500Z
> LAST-MODIFIED:20070814T150738Z
> X-SONYERICSSON-DST:4
> X-IRMC-LUID:000000000087
> END:VEVENT
> END:VCALENDAR
> 
> 
> And here is the syncml_log.txt:
> 
> DEBUG:  Backend of class SyncML_Backend_Horde created
> DEBUG:  New session created: 4c6f9a66d4769748ed319096ef3c1625
> DEBUG:  Invalid authorization!
> DEBUG:  authorized= version=2 msgid=1 source=IMEI:XXXX 
> target=https://XXXX/horde/rpc.php user= charset=UTF-8 wbxml=1
> DEBUG:  Received Final from client.
> DEBUG:  Sending Final to client.
> DEBUG:  SyncML: return message completed
> DEBUG:  Finished at 2007-08-26 10:55:04. Packet logged in 
> /tmp/sync/syncml_server_10.wbxml
> 
> DEBUG:  Backend of class SyncML_Backend_Horde created
> DEBUG:  Existing session continued: 4c6f9a66d4769748ed319096ef3c1625
> DEBUG:  checking auth for user=XXXXX
> DEBUG:  authorized=1 version=2 msgid=2 source=IMEI:XXXX 
> target=https://XXXX/horde/rpc.php user=XXXXX charset=UTF-8 wbxml=1
> DEBUG:  previous sync found for database: calendar; client-ts: 286
> DEBUG:  SyncML: Anchor match, TwoWaySync since 286
> DEBUG:  Create new sync for calendar; synctype=200
> DEBUG:  previous sync found for database: contacts; client-ts: 206
> DEBUG:  SyncML: Anchor match, TwoWaySync since 206
> DEBUG:  Create new sync for contacts; synctype=200
> DEBUG:  previous sync found for database: notes; client-ts: 6
> DEBUG:  SyncML: Anchor match, TwoWaySync since 6
> DEBUG:  Create new sync for notes; synctype=200
> DEBUG:  previous sync found for database: tasks; client-ts: 286
> DEBUG:  SyncML: Anchor match, TwoWaySync since 286
> DEBUG:  Create new sync for tasks; synctype=200
> DEBUG:  HandleFinal for state=0
> DEBUG:  HandleFinal for state=0
> DEBUG:  HandleFinal for state=0
> DEBUG:  HandleFinal for state=0
> DEBUG:  Received Final from client.
> DEBUG:  Sending Final to client.
> DEBUG:  SyncML: return message completed
> DEBUG:  Finished at 2007-08-26 10:55:06. Packet logged in 
> /tmp/sync/syncml_server_11.wbxml
> 
> 
> Best regard,
> Anders
> 
> Karsten Fourmont wrote:
>> Hi,
>>
>>  > I do also have the files from /tmp/sync but I don't know which files
>>  > that might have any interest.
>>
>> can you post /tmp/syncml_log.txt?
>>
>> also one calendar entry with an alarm from /tmp/sync/data.txt would be 
>> great.
>>
>> Cheers,
>>  Karsten
>>
>> Anders Tietze wrote:
>>> Hi,
>>>
>>> I have a problem when I try to synchronize the calendar of my SE W880i.
>>>
>>> If I add calendar entries in the kronolith calendar, I am able to 
>>> synchronize the calendar with my phone, but if I add/modify an entry 
>>> in my phone calendar and try to synchronize that the phone reports 
>>> "illegal answer from server" and the following lines are printed in 
>>> the php error log.
>>>
>>> [26-aug-2007 10:55:07] PHP Warning:  array_keys() [<a 
>>> href='function.array-keys'>function.array-keys</a>]: The first 
>>> argument should be an array in /horde/kronolith/lib/Driver.php on 
>>> line 1170
>>>
>>> [26-aug-2007 10:55:07] PHP Warning:  array_keys() [<a 
>>> href='function.array-keys'>function.array-keys</a>]: The first 
>>> argument should be an array in /horde/kronolith/lib/Driver.php on 
>>> line 1170
>>>
>>> [26-aug-2007 10:55:07] PHP Warning:  array_keys() [<a 
>>> href='function.array-keys'>function.array-keys</a>]: The first 
>>> argument should be an array in /horde/kronolith/lib/Driver.php on 
>>> line 1170
>>>
>>> [26-aug-2007 10:55:08] PHP Fatal error:  Call to undefined method 
>>> PEAR_Error::getUID() in /horde/kronolith/lib/Driver/sql.php on line 630
>>>
>>> I do also have the files from /tmp/sync but I don't know which files 
>>> that might have any interest.
>>>
>>> I can't figure out what causes the problem so any help is appreciated.
>>>
>>> BTW. I use the latest (25-aug-2007) cvs version of horde.
>>>
>>> Best regards,
>>> Anders
>>>
>>>
>>



More information about the sync mailing list